Another prospective petition regarding making Douglas County a county of Idaho was accepted by the Douglas County Clerk on February 11.
The Douglas County ballot initiative amends a 1997 ordinance to add Idaho officials to the list of officials who may be lobbied by Douglas County commissioners. The suggested ballot question is “Shall the County Board be authorized to advocate for Idaho legislation, such as making this county a county of Idaho?”
In order to appear on the Nov 3, 2020 ballot in Douglas County, we must gather 2955 valid signatures from Douglas County voters by August 5.
